Property Report
This semi-detached house in St. Ives, Cambridgeshire, was built between 1950 and 1966. The property has a floor area of 113 square meters and is fully double-glazed. It features a mains gas boiler and radiators for heating, and hot water is drawn from the main system. The energy rating is D, and the current annual energy cost is £875. The property has 5 heated rooms and a pitched roof with 200mm loft insulation. The house was last sold in 2014 for £272,500. - Based on our analysis, this property has a HomeScore of 660 out of 999.
